Our critical care unit strives to provide each patient with individualized, compassionate treatment. This includes round-the-clock consultant doctor coverage as well as highly trained nursing staff who look after the patient’s psychological and emotional needs.
Patients admitted under all specialties and super specialties, including polytrauma patients, are cared for in the critical care section. Critical care is backed up by round-the-clock laboratory and radiology capabilities. With approximately 100 monitor beds, the hospital has the most critical care beds in the region. The ICU provides high-tech multi-parameter monitoring and care, which is staffed 24 hours a day by expert intensivists. The inside air quality, which is maintained by dedicated air supply units and ensures vital care free of contamination, is a standout feature.   • Only closed ICU in Kanpur.
  • State of art 6 bedded ICU facility.
  • Standard manpower with 1 : 1 nurse to patient ratio.
  • 50 – 60% occupancy rate.
  • 70% survival to discharge rate.

ICU Procedures:

  • Endotracheal intubation.
  • USG guided central venous and arterial line insertion.
  • Advanced hemodymanic monitoring.
  • Noninvasive ventilator support (BIPAP and CPAP)
  • Advanced intensive mechanical ventilator support
  • ABG Analysis
  • NT Pro BNP
  • TROP I, Procalcitonin
  • Bedside hemodialysis
  • Bedside diagnostic & therapeutic video and fibre optic bronchoscopy.
  • Bronchoscopy guided endotracheal intubation
  • Perculeneous trachostomy.
  • Specialised training of staff in ICU and regular classes and academic activities.
